Aaron David Miller, a former State Department insider, is casting doubt on President Trump's narrative, arguing it's "not credible" that Iran was just weeks away from developing a nuclear weapon. He also warns the conflict could backfire pushing Iran closer to a nuclear weapon.

US Energy Secretary Chris Wright says oil from the US strategic reserve started flowing on Friday afternoon. "Prices have not risen high enough yet to drive meaningful demand destruction," Wright said during a discussion at CERA Week in Houston.
